“People do business with people. People they KNOW LIKE & TRUST”

The quickest way to build trust is in person. We take our queues from how people behaviour both verbally and non verbally and first impressions really do count.

1. Don’t Work the Room

Aim to have quality interactions not quantity.

 

Meet 2 or 3 people per event and reconnect with people you have meet before however you don’t know very well. Don’t be that person who is moving from person to person thrusting their business cards at anyone who will take them.

2. Have a Few Wuestions Prepared in Advance

Ask a question relating to the event or what business they are in. Let them talk so that you can make a connection with them. Actively listen to the person you are with and hear what they are saying rather than just waiting for your turn to speak.

Ask followup questions and be genuinely interested in what the person is saying.

3. Follow Up

If you make a connection with some people and feel you could add value to their business, ask for their business card. After the event write a couple notes to what you spoke about. The next day email, say hi, that you met at the event and mention what you talked about.
